BPV recirculates the excess air back through the system. Quieter. BOV vents the excess air to the atmosphere. Louder.

Our cars come stock with a BPV and that's what your replacing for a better BPV (Forge one)

Originally Posted by cobaltj
Ok thanks for clearing that up so whats a bpv is that what makes the sound after letting off the fuel. I thought that was a blow off valve but please forgive me im new to all this...

Most turbo vehicles have Blow Off Valves, they shoot the air out of the system and into the atmosphere.

However, our cars have a Bypass Valve. It's the same as a BOV but it shoots the excess air back into the intake so we can take advantage of no-lift-shift, allowing for quicker spooling after shifting.
